Output 3d02636ef89bc0c5e24da15026e216a75a6220b0523ba90a1cfaf1587eb7e348:0

value
1900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ee0aedd3948c376211ded605b22daf54bbcc56b9 OP_EQUAL
address
3PPfqZT743zSXn2e1o7yNNpTaFtn3C7cdr
transaction
3d02636ef89bc0c5e24da15026e216a75a6220b0523ba90a1cfaf1587eb7e348
spent
true